This dataset contains the data and scripts used in Coevolving topography, patchy soils, and forest structure by Rossi et al. (2026). Files are organized into five main directories:gis_data: In this directory, you will find drone_ortho.tif and a geodatabase called features.gdb. Drone data was acquired on July 21, 2021 using a DJI Phantom 4 Pro. Lidar data was acquired by the National Center for Airborne Laser Mapping (NCALM) and are archived and freely accessible at OpenTopography. While the source DEM and DSM data are not archived in this repository, the gis files provided here will allow you to geolocate examples shown in the main text. See readme.txt files for more details.accuracy_assessment: In this directory, you will find the matlab scripts and data used for accuracy assessment in an 8.1 hectare region along North Beaver Creek, Rampart Range, CO, USA. Documentation is provided within matlab files. Functions from TopoToolbox will be needed.elevation_analysis: In this directory, you will find the matlab scripts and data used to extract stream profiles and quantify changes in bedrock exposure as a function of elevation. Documentation is provided within matlab files. Functions from TopoToolbox will be needed.aspect_analysis: In this directory, you will find the matlab scripts and data used to quantify differences in bedrock exposure, canopy height, and crown density as a function of topographic aspect. Documentation is provided within matlab files. Functions from TopoToolbox will be needed.landlab: In this directory, you will find two folders called model and model_output. The model is built using the Python-based modeling library called Landlab. Specifically, this hillslope evolution model simulates depth-dependent soil creep and humped soil production on a 2D swath hillslope. Model scenarios can take a long time to run so model outputs are provided for all scenarios shown in the main text and supporting materials for this manuscript. See readme.txt files within subdirectories for more details.
